Ethereum Climbs 0.22% to Close at $3,225.38 Amidst Bullish Market Sentiment

Overview of Today's Market (January 7, 2026)

  • Opening Price: $3,218.21
  • Closing Price: $3,225.38
  • Highest Price: $3,250.00
  • Lowest Price: $3,200.00
  • Amplitude: Approximately 1.00%

Intraday Fluctuation Phases

Ethereum experienced a steady rise in the morning, reaching a high of $3,250.00 before encountering selling pressure that brought the price back down to around $3,200.00 in the early afternoon. The price then recovered slightly towards the closing price.

Trading Volume and Capital Flow

  • 24-hour Trading Volume: $24.65 billion
  • Liquidation Data: The total liquidations across the network were approximately $14.82 million, with long liquidations at $11.49 million and short liquidations at $3.33 million.
  • Long-Short Ratio: The current long-short ratio indicates a slight inclination towards long positions, reflecting a bullish sentiment among traders.
